Here's the other card the ladies made at Hostess Club in March. Since we're getting near the Easter season, it's time to think of those Easter cards we want to send out. Usually I go for a more Christ related theme, but thought this one would be fun and 'eggsactly' right. Stamps: Easter Blossoms Cardstock: Crumb Cake, Confetti White, with Springtime Vintage Designer Series Paper Ink: Soft Suede, Daffodil Delight, Marina Mist, and Pretty In Pink Accessories: choices of Very Vanilla Seam Binding Ribbon or 5/8" Satin Ribbon, Basic Pearls or Rhinestones, Subtle Collection Designer Buttons, Hemp Twine, and Mini Glue Dots Oops, looks like I messed up and took a pic of my sample for the 'before' choices and not the finished one. Each of the ladies used either rhinestones or pearls in the center of their eggs. Really cute, but you'll just have to imagine them on my sample card! Then there was the choice of ribbon. With the seam binding ribbon being fairly new, I wanted to use it on this card. After this one was made, I got the idea for the Vanilla Satin Ribbon. Oooh, so much more rich and elegant looking. And with it being a little wider and heavier, it scrunches up in the middle nicer than the seam binding. There was a choice of the blue or rose buttons also. Both looked very nice with the card.
